Irma la Douce -- Paris? the red-light district. A rookie police officer, Nestor Patou (Jack Lemmon), falls for a beautiful prostitute, Irma la Douce (Shirley MacLaine). Before long, Nestor discovers that the only way to keep Irma is to become her new pimp, and the only way to accomplish that is to knock the block off the present pimp. As a result, Nestor becomes #1 pimp on the block. It is not long, though, before he becomes insanely jealous of Irma's customers. Despairing, Nestor devises a way to keep Irma all for himself, yet allow her to continue in her profession. And when the plan backfires, there is only one person who can help him... but will she believe him? Lemmon's comic performance, under the direction of Billy Wilder, has been compared to some of the great visual comedy of the silent comedians.

Alex, a self-absorbed young painter, is having a bad day. He doesn't get the art show he's been expecting, his girlfriend kicks him out, and he finds himself living in a low rent Hollywood apartment with an ironclad lease. Rejected, dejected, and surrounded by an assortment of neighbors he'd rather avoid, his downward spiraling life takes a turn when Lori, a country girl from Colorado, fresh out of the Air Force, moves in across the hall. It soon becomes apparent to Alex, though, that as convenient as it is to date someone across the hall, it's even more inconvenient to have her still living there when you try to break up.

What do you call a cowboy with his brains kicked out? A bronc rider. Ben Jones and Howdy Lewis are bronc riders. Glenn Ford and Henry Fonda portray the pair who are cowboy enough to do just about any job, except for the one at hand. That job: Saddle a clever, ornery, blaze-faced roan named Old Fooler and make him as gentle as a milk-pen calf. Can't be done, and that gets the cowpokes to thinking. Maybe they can make a dollar or two by wagering that no one at the rodeo can stay atop him either.
